Flagstaff Hill Maritime Museum and Village
Container - Bottle, 1840s to 1910
This handmade ‘gallon’ style of bottle was generally used for storing and transporting wine and ale. Many bottles similar to this one have their bases embossed with “6 TO THE GALLON”. It is one of many artefacts recovered from an unidentified shipwrecks along Victoria’s coast between the late 1960s and the early 1970s. It is now part of the John Chance Collection. The capacity of this is one-sixth of a gallon (imperial measure), which is equal to 758 ml. (American bottles were often inscribed “5 TO THE GALLON”, which is one-fifth of an American gallon, equal to 757 ml.) Contemporary home brewers can purchase new ‘6 to gallon’ bottles that hold 750 ml. and are sold in cases of 36 bottles, which is equal to 6 gallons of wine. Glass was made thousands of years ago by heating together quartz-sand (Silica), lime and potash. Potash was obtained from burnt wood, but these days potash is mined. The natural sand had imperfections such as different forms of iron, resulting in ‘black’ glass, which was really dark green or dark amber colour. The ‘black’ glass was enhanced by residual carbon in the potash. Black glass is rarely used nowadays but most beer, wine, and liquors are still sold in dark coloured glass. Glass vessels were core-formed from around 1500 BC. An inner core with the vessel’s shape was formed around a rod using a porous material such as clay or dung. Molten glass was then modelled around the core and decorated. When the glass had cooled the vessel was immersed in water and the inner core became liquid and was washed out. Much more recently, bottlers were crafted by a glassblower using molten glass and a blow pipe together with other hand tools. Another method was using simple moulds, called dip moulds, that allowed the glass to be blown into the mould to form the base, then the glassblower would continue blowing free-form to shape the shoulders and neck. The bottle was then finished by applying a lip. These moulded bottles were more uniform in shape compared to the free-form bottles originally produced. English glassblowers in the mid-1800s were making some bottles with 2-piece and 3-piece moulds, some with a push-up style base, sometimes with embossing in the base as well. Improvements allowed the moulds to also have embossed and patterned sides, and straight sided shapes such as hexagons. Bottles made in full moulds usually displayed seam seams or lines. These process took skill and time, making the bottles valuable, so they were often recycled. By the early 20th century bottles were increasingly machine made, which greatly reduced the production time and cost. This bottle is historically significant as an example of a handmade, blown inscribed glass bottle manufactured in the mid-to-late 1800s for specific use as a liquor bottle with a set measurement of one-sixth of gallon. It is also historically significant as an example of liquor bottles imported into Colonial Victoria in the mid-to-late 1800s, giving a snapshot into history and social life that occurred during the early days of Victoria’s development, and the sea trade that visited the ports in those days. The bottle is also significant as one of a group of bottles recovered by John Chance, a diver in Victoria’s coastal waters in the late 1960s to early 1970s. Items that come from several wrecks have since been donated to the Flagstaff Hill Maritime Village’s museum collection of shipwreck artefacts by his family, illustrating this item’s level of historical value. Bendigo Historical Society Inc.
Functional object - Polishing Iron
Polishing irons were used for ironing collars and frills. Historical information Sad-irons (the term comes from an old word sald for solid) were made by blacksmiths and used to smooth out material by pressing the hot iron over it. A piece of sheet -iron was placed over the kitchen fire and the irons placed on it could be heated whilst remaining clean of ash.. The women used 2 irons - one heating while the other was used. Thick cloth or gloves protected their hands from the hot irons. The cool iron was replaced on the fire or stove to heat again. These irons were cleaned with steel wool to prevent them marking the material. If the iron was too hot the material would scorch. Most homes set aside one day for ironing and some large households had an ironing room with a special stove designed to heat irons. However, most women had to work with a heavy, hot iron close to the fireplace even in summer. Ambulance Victoria Museum
Humidicrib, CIG, Port-O-Cot, The Commonwealth Industrial Gases Limited
Humidicribs are used to transport sick babies from small hospitals to major hospitals for specialist care. They work by maintaining normal body temperature and provide oxygen if needed during ambulance transit. Known by a variety of commercial names, earlier humidicribs were ones heated with water bottles. Not part of an ambulances standard equipment, humidicribs are kept in ambulance stations and carried if babies needed to be transported. In the early days before humidicribs came into use and when air ambulances did not exist, many more babies died during emergency transits than do today Manufactured by the Commonwealth Industrial Gases Limited (better known as CIG), Australian-made Port-O-Cot brand humidicribs came replaced timber home-made humidicribs. They had electrical heating and easy to control oxygen flow and humidity control equipment. CIG also noted that noted that: Once the baby has been placed inside, the cot need not be opened, all nursing operations being carried out through the iris armholes. Even though the baby is in complete isolation nursing is a straight forward matter… The iris armholes allow nurses to feed, weigh, take temperatures, change napkins or, in fact, carry out any procedures without changing or disturbing the atmosphere within the cot. Happily for ambulance officers and nurses, the new Port-O-Cots were also much lighter and easy to carry than their old timber ones! metal box with carry handles and Perspex opening top. Wodonga & District Historical Society Inc
Domestic object - Beaten Copper fire screen
Fire screens were developed early in the 19th century to prevent sparks from flying into the room or logs rolling out when a fire was left unattended. They also served as ornamental or decorative items, particularly ones such as this fire screen made from beaten or forged copper. Their decorations often depicted rural scenes.This item is representative of fire screens used in Australian homes to protect them from fire during the 19th and early 20th century when open fires were the main form of household heating.A fire screen made from beaten copper with a wooden frame. Wodonga & District Historical Society Inc
Decorative object - Hand carved Wooden Bellows, James Ripper, c1900
The fireplace was the main heating source for small houses before 1900, so a bellows to coax a flame from a dying fire was important. They would also be used to keep the fire going in a woodfire oven for cooking. In later cooking ranges, domestic water supply was also heated through the cooking range so bellows helped to maintaing a supply of hot water. These bellows were handcrafted by Mr James Ripper, a great uncle of Mrs. Jean Raper. An item of signifance throughout Australia, bellows were used in homes to coax a domestic fire into flame for heating and cooking purposes. It was probably used in late 19th to early 20th century homes.A set of hand carved wooden bellows. Each side of the bellows was crafted from one piece of timber. Glenelg Shire Council Cultural Collection
Functional object - Foot Warmer, Hecla Electrics Pty Ltd, c. 1920
From Museum Victoria: Made in about 1927 by Hecla Electrics Pty Ltd and sold under the model name 'Foot Warma'. The foot warmer was made from the late 1920s until the 1950s and did not change substantially in design during this time. The Hecla brand name and logo was registered in 1918 by Clarence Marriott. It was inspired by the recent eruption of Iceland's volcano Mt Heckla. Clarence and his father James were metal workers who had made Australia's first carbon filament electric radiators in 1899, and also built an early steam car. As electricity use exploded in the 1920s and 1930s, 'Hecla' became a household name in Melbourne. They made a wide range of appliances for the home, and supplied commercial appliances to cafés, hospitals and offices. In 1927, the company shifted from small premises in the city to a bigger, electric-powered factory in South Yarra. Hecla had no retail stores of its own - instead it sold products through wholesalers and retailers, including the State Electricity Commission (SEC). The company promoted its goods through advertisements in home magazines and displays in shop windows, home shows and the 1935 All-Electricity Exhibition. A popular advertising slogan in the 1930s was 'Hecla household helps make happy healthy housewives!'. Hecla ceased manufacturing in Melbourne in the 1980s.Documentation of how people lived and is an example of early domestic electrical appliances. From Museum Victoria: Hecla Electrics Pty Ltd were a significant Melbourne manufacturing company, who became a household name in the 1920s making small electric appliances such as heaters and kettles. They also made a variety of other electrical appliances for domestic, commercial and military use. The company manufactured electric appliances in Melbourne from about 1922 until the 1980s, although Clarence Marriott, who formed the company, had begun making radiators with his father James in 1899. The company had a reputation for quality products. The company also played an important role within the Australian domestic and commercial appliance industry, both as a leading innovator and through its role in training skilled staff, many of whom went on to work for competitors such as Kambrook, Electrolux and Sunbeam. This electric coffee percolator represents the typical small domestic appliance that the Hecla company was famous for. Along with other items in the Hecla Collection, it highlights the diversity of electric appliances that the company made. This object also highlights the legacy of high quality design and metal construction work that Clarence and James established for the company, stemming from their early work as talented art metal workers. It also represents the first major period of the take-up of electricity use in the home. This take-up began in the 1920s and 1930s with the use of small appliances, and by the 1950s electricity had become commonplace in the home, and large appliances such as refrigerators and stoves became standard.Square metal object. Mont De Lancey
Domestic object - Glass Preserving Jars, Fowler's, c 1915+
Fowler's Vacola preserving jars have a rich history, beginning in 1915 with Joseph Fowler in Melbourne, Australia. Inspired by his uncle's fruit-preserving business in England, Fowler developed a method for home bottling and preserving food, which became particularly popular during the Depression era. The system relies on heating contents to a specific temperature (92°C) for a set time (one hour) to achieve a sterile and sealed product. Fowler's Vacola is still a popular method for preserving food today, and the company continues to manufacture preserving kits and accessories.
